Web2 de abr. de 2024 · 6. Get a Cheap Dehumidifier. The use of cheap dehumidifier in your home may help you control the high humidity in your home. Once you turn the dehumidifier on, it’ll start pulling the warm air and filtering it through a set of coils. When the air touches these coils, it cools down and pulls the moisture from it. Web16 de ago. de 2024 · Excessive humidity in your house can cause mildew to grow in any dark corner it can find. Which means it will not be obvious to your eyes. So trust your nose, if you smell mildew, you are smelling a symptom of high humidity. 6. Air conditioner doesn’t feel like it’s running
